Job Summary

  • The Maintenance Program Manager ensures the safety, reliability, and performance of campus facilities by leading maintenance teams and managing and coordinating contractual work with external vendors and service providers.
  • The University of Arkansas offers a vibrant work environment and a workplace culture that promotes a healthy work-life balance.
  • The benefits package includes university contributions to health, dental, life and disability insurance, tuition waivers for employees and their families, 12 official holidays, immediate leave accrual, and a choice of retirement programs.

Key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ree in engineering, construction management, facilities management, or related field
  • At least four years of experience in facilities maintenance, building systems, engineering, utilities operations, or related infrastructure support
  • Experience supervising teams in a related field
  • Experience coordinating contractors or vendor services
